1. Новые складчины

    25.07.2017: Кaк всегo зa 7 дней устaнoвить тишину, пoрядoк и пoслушaние в доме?

    24.07.2017: Даосские практики для лица

    24.07.2017: Шьем женское белье-6

    24.07.2017: Простое пальто

    24.07.2017: Омоложение. Закрытая

    24.07.2017: Всё о жиросжигании с экспертом по фитнесу

    24.07.2017: Чтение как приключение. Как читать с ребенком книги

    24.07.2017: [Фом] Два букета в одном стиле

    24.07.2017: Рецепт от рака из Третьего Рейха , продления жизни и 25 других серьезных заболеваний [ENG]

    24.07.2017: SMM: Индустрия моды (SFBA)

    24.07.2017: Tooligram Professional 2.6.8

    24.07.2017: InstaTool Pro 1.6.9.7

    23.07.2017: Молодость и новые зубы

    22.07.2017: Упругие орехи, а не мятые булки,курс - крутые ягодицы горячим летом

    21.07.2017: Архетип счастья. Влияние на жизнь (2017)

    20.07.2017: Как управлять женщинами. Практическое руководство для менеджера

    19.07.2017: Вегетарианский онлайн-курс "Вторые блюда"

    19.07.2017: 129 способов заработать в путешествиях + Видеокурс

    19.07.2017: PHP НА ПРИМЕРАХ

    19.07.2017: [Шитьё] Купальники. Выкройка

    19.07.2017: Остеопатия. Метод SEST базовый уровень

    19.07.2017: Лифтинг лба, переносицы и бровей

    19.07.2017: Как устранить двойной подбородок

    17.07.2017: Ясно видеть

    17.07.2017: Материализация мыслей

    17.07.2017: Орально-мануальные ласки+массаж

    17.07.2017: "Терпеливый родитель"

    17.07.2017: К.Бордунос. Альфа-контроль в бизнесе

    14.07.2017: Курс «Внимание. Память. Мышление»

    14.07.2017: Играем - мозг развиваем

    14.07.2017: Читаем по лицу и узнаем свои энергии

    14.07.2017: Молодая кожа и шикарные волосы

    14.07.2017: Как создать поток клиентов на консультации

    13.07.2017: 3в1-Стройность, исцеление и самореализация для женщин (закрытая)

    13.07.2017: Аюрведические практики при головной боли и мигрени, воспалении ушей и горла

    13.07.2017: Пусть подружки скажут -вау! Стань бессовестно красивой этим летом

    13.07.2017: Старт в счастливую любовь

    13.07.2017: swSpyBrowser - интернет мультибраузер в каждой вкладке свои cookies, useragent и IP-адрес

    12.07.2017: Самое ценное текущего года- молодость 2017

    12.07.2017: Александром Приходько - Тренинг "Моделирование совершенства"

    12.07.2017: Трансформационный Тренинг. Женственность, преображение

    12.07.2017: Кто я? Встреча с самим собой

    12.07.2017: Белая защитная магия. Знать и действовать

    12.07.2017: Обучающий видеокурс по Slider Revolution

    12.07.2017: Жучек-букашка. Объемная вышивка

    10.07.2017: Стройность на автопилоте

    10.07.2017: Веб-разработчик 9.0

    07.07.2017: Нейробиология для родителей: как вырастить невероятных детей

    05.07.2017: Отправь работодателя в нокаут. Грамотно защити свои права

    05.07.2017: Курс по выпечке хлеба

    05.07.2017: Метрический справочник. Данные для архитектурного проектирования и расчета

    05.07.2017: Набор программ для проектировщиков

    05.07.2017: [Альпина]Теряя невинность:Как я построил бизнес, делая все по-своему и получая удовольствие от жизни

    03.07.2017: Рецепт настоящего коньяка ускоренного приготовления без потери качества ( п'ять лет выдержки за 6

    03.07.2017: Психология счастья (Уровень I и II). Бордунос

    02.07.2017: Мужчины. Руководство.

    29.06.2017: Элитный курс «Персональный тренер»

    28.06.2017: Закрытая. Всё о женском наслаждении

    21.06.2017: Работа с подсознанием

    21.06.2017: Даосские секреты отношений

  2. Нужен организатор

    03.07.2017: Рецепт настоящего коньяка ускоренного приготовления без потери качества ( п'ять лет выдержки за 6

    15.06.2017: Интенсив по заработку на фрилансе

    14.05.2017: Кукла от известного автора

    27.04.2017: Вебинары К. Довлатова по "сказкам" с реинтеграциями

    21.04.2017: Управление временем и путь в безсмертие.

    13.04.2017: Сергей Домогацкий - Путь

    28.03.2017: Рецепты для диеты - книга

    27.03.2017: Эзотерический марафон "Новая Я"

    03.03.2017: Торт-раскраска

    15.08.2016: В каждом ребенке солнце

    15.08.2016: Испания. Гастрономия

    15.08.2016: Книги по китайской медицине. Часть 2.

    15.08.2016: Логотип и фирменный стиль. Руководство дизайнера

    15.08.2016: Налоги за 14 дней. Экспресс-курс. Новое, 14-е изд.

    15.08.2016: Голубая точка. Космическое будущее человечества

    15.08.2016: Бесплодие — диагноз или приговор

    15.08.2016: Руководство по самоисцелению

    15.08.2016: Хорошие девочки отправляются на небеса, а плохие – куда захотят

    15.08.2016: Гипноз и другие фишки на сайте или секреты продающих сайтов

    03.08.2016: Любовная Совместимость. Методика Разведчиков

    19.01.2016: Ментальный курс от Александра Росса

    25.08.2014: IonCube v8.3 Decoder + PHP Script Auto-Fixer

Раздача [Специалист] Алгоритмы. Олимпиадное программирование

Тема в разделе "[WEB] Программирование, администрирование", создана пользователем goldboy, 30 авг 2014.

  1. TopicStarter Overlay
     
    goldboy
    offline

    goldboy Контент-менеджер VIP

    Сообщения:
    72
    Симпатии:
    58
    Монеты:
    Репутация:
    94
    http://skladchik.com/threads/Специалист-Алгоритмы-Олимпиадное-программирование.22263/

    Вы узнаете, что такое олимпиадное программирование, и в чем заключаются особенности автоматической проверки алгоритмов. Вы познакомитесь с тестирующей системой Ejudge, в которой проходят все крупнейшие соревнования по спортивному программированию. Вы сможете на лету решать такие задачи, как разложение числа на цифры, на простые множители, делимость, арифметика остатков. Вы освоите классические алгоритмы и хитрые трюки для решения задач на обработку последовательностей, изучите различные методы сортировки, в том числе использующие тонкие

    По окончании курса Вы будете уметь:

    Легко решать задачи обработки матриц: линейный поиск, переворот, максимумы и минимумы.
    Приступите к основам высшего пилотажа в программировании – алгоритмам обработки графов, стеков и очередей.
    Полученных знаний и навыков Вам хватит, чтобы начать выступать на олимпиадах по программированию.

    Программа курса

    Модуль 1. Занятие №1. Знакомство
    Алгоритмы
    Тестирующая система
    Модуль 2. Занятие №2. Типы данных и отладка
    Типы данных в Java
    Примитивные типы
    Объекты
    Классы-обертки
    BigInteger и BigDecimal
    Отладка
    Модуль 3. Занятие №3. Решение задач из области арифметики
    Проверка на четность
    Немного теории
    Цифры числа
    Получение цифр числа
    Проверка на простоту
    Сумма делителей
    Количество делителей
    Разложение на простые множители
    Модуль 4. Занятие №4. НОД(GCD) и НОК(LCM)
    Немного теории
    Немного о задачах
    Модуль 5. Занятие №5. Однопроходные алгоритмы
    Чтение
    Сумма элементов
    Максимум из всех
    Максимум из четных
    Второй максимум
    Немного о задачах
    Чтение больших объемов данных
    Пример использования класса
    StreamTokenizer для быстрого чтения последовательности чисел
    Модуль 6. Занятие №6. Массивы
    Создание массива
    Ввод (считывание) массива из N элементов
    Вывод всех элементов массива
    Поиск максимума
    Поиск индекса максимального
    Поиск индекса заданного числа в массиве
    Вывод массива в обратном порядке
    Косвенная адресация
    Модуль 7. Занятие №7. Сортировка массива
    Сортировка выбором (метод минимума)
    Немного теории
    Метод сортировки обменами (метод пузырька)
    Модуль 8. Занятие №8. Символы и строки в Java
    Символы
    Класс String
    Создание строки
    Чтение строки
    Длина строки
    Сравнение строк
    Добавление к строке
    Преобразование различных типов в строку и обратно
    Извлечение символа и подстроки
    Поиск в строке
    Функции замены
    Разворот строки
    Модуль 9. Занятие №9. Двумерные массивы
    Создание и «стандартное» чтение
    Вывод массива в виде таблицы
    Cумма всех элементов
    Сумма элементов главной диагонали
    Неровные массивы
    Модуль 10. Занятие №10. Графы I. Определения, хранение
    Немного теории
    Основные понятия
    Деревья
    Способы хранения графов
    Способ №0. Иногда граф можно вообще не хранить специальным образом
    Способ №1. Матрица смежности
    Способ №2. Список ребер
    Способ №3. Списки смежности
    Модуль 11. Занятие №11. Стек и очередь
    Стек (Stack)
    Очередь (Queue)
    Модуль 12. Занятие №12. Графы II. Поиск в ширину
    BFS (Breadth-first search)
    BFS в графе, заданном матрицей смежности G
    Применения алгоритма поиска в ширину
    Поиск кратчайших путей из данной
    Немного теории
    Поиск компонент связности

    Скрытое содержимое:
    **Для просмотра скрытого текста/ссылки у вас должно быть не менее 20 сообщений.**
    Или
    Приобрести премиум-доступ ко всем ссылкам
    Последние данные очков репутации:
    Verona: 5 Очки 31 авг 2014



    Titov66 и lora нравится это.
  2.  
    special4
    offline

    special4 Хамстер-Премиум Премиум VIP

    Сообщения:
    8
    Симпатии:
    0
    Монеты:
    Репутация:
    0
    курс супер
    20 сообщений за него - адекватная цена ))

    плюс к нему прочитать книгу "Алгоритмы. Построение и анализ" от Томас Х. Кормен, Чарльз И. Лейзерсон, Рональд Л. Ривест, Клиффорд Штайн

    и вы смотрите на код уже совсем другими глазами. Настоящий апгрейд мозга.



  3.  
    kostya67
    offline

    kostya67 -----

    Сообщения:
    21
    Симпатии:
    4
    Монеты:
    Репутация:
    126
    Блин ребят ,а полный курс та есть у кого? Там только 5 уроков,тоесть 8 акч ,а не 20акч



  4.  
    HereIAm
    offline

    HereIAm Хамстер

    Сообщения:
    19
    Симпатии:
    5
    Монеты:
    Репутация:
    0
    Обожаю олимпиадный кодинг, и жду не дождусь, когда программирование выйдет на новый уровень, и олимпиадки будут проводить не на питоне, или Сишке, а на haskell, истинно изящном языке. С курсом этим я уже ознакомлен, и был доволен как слон, только решая такие задачки можно нормально размять мозг. Ирония ведь в том, что олимпиадные задачи, в работе и продакшене вообще не нужны, это просто код ради кода сплошной :)



DDoS Protection Powered by  DDos-GuarD